How have smart contracts been optimized in Aave V3 for better performance?
Exploring Smart Contract Optimizations in Aave V3 for Enhanced Performance
Introduction
Aave V3, the latest iteration of the decentralized lending protocol Aave, has brought about significant advancements in smart contract optimization. These optimizations aim to improve performance, efficiency, and user experience within the DeFi ecosystem. In this article, we delve into the key optimizations implemented in Aave V3 and their impact on the platform's functionality.
Context: Understanding Aave V3
Aave is a decentralized lending protocol operating on the Ethereum blockchain that enables users to lend and borrow cryptocurrencies. With the release of Aave V3, developers have focused on enhancing performance, security features, and overall usability of the platform to cater to evolving market demands.
Reserve Factor Reduction: Enhancing Liquidity Provider Earnings
Background:
The reserve factor dictates how much interest earned by the protocol is allocated to liquidity providers.
Optimization:
In Aave V3, a notable optimization involves reducing the reserve factor from 50% to 20%. This adjustment aims to increase liquidity provider earnings by distributing more interest their way while incentivizing greater participation in providing liquidity.
Variable Reserve Factor: Adapting to Market Dynamics
Background:
Traditional reserve factors are fixed and may not adapt well to changing market conditions.
Optimization:
Aave V3 introduces a variable reserve factor that can be adjusted based on market dynamics. This flexibility allows for better adaptation to fluctuating interest rates and liquidity levels within DeFi environments.
Improved Gas Efficiency: Minimizing Transaction Costs
Background:
High gas fees on Ethereum can impact transaction costs associated with executing smart contracts.
Optimization:
Smart contracts in Aave V3 have been optimized for improved gas efficiency through streamlined algorithms and reduced unnecessary operations. This optimization lowers overall gas costs for transactions within the platform.
Enhanced Security Features: Safeguarding User Funds
Background:
Security is paramount in DeFi protocols due to potential vulnerabilities.
Optimization:
Aave V3 incorporates enhanced security features such as improved access controls and robust auditing processes. These measures bolster user fund protection and mitigate risks associated with potential exploits.
User Interface Improvements: Enhancing User Experience
Background:
User-friendly interfaces are crucial for attracting and retaining users in DeFi platforms.
Optimization:
The user interface of Aave V3 has been revamped for a more intuitive experience with streamlined navigation, clearer information display, and improved onboarding processes aimed at enhancing user engagement.
Recent Developments & Community Response
- Launch Date: October 24th marked the launch of AAVE v3.
- Community Feedback: Users have welcomed these improvements appreciating enhanced performance & security features.
- Market Impact: The optimizations have fueled growth & adoption within DeFi space particularly attracting both borrowers & liquidity providers alike.
Potential Challenges Ahead
Regulatory Uncertainty: Regulatory scrutiny could affect operations due its decentralized nature.
Market Volatility: Fluctuations could impact platform performance during downturns.
Smart Contract Bugs
- Despite optimizations bugs or vulnerabilities may still pose risks
Competition: Stiff competition necessitates continuous innovation efforts from AAVE v3
This article provides an insightful overview of how smart contracts have been optimized in AAVE v3 focusing on improving performance metrics while addressing potential challenges ahead as it continues its journey towards innovation within Decentralized Finance (DeFi) landscape.

Hot Topics


